    Ready Player One

    Based on a book of the same name.

    Lots of 80’s references and more on top of that. Story is about a Virtual Reality game called the Oasis and the hunt for keys hidden in the game, that will lead to the finder of all three to becoming the owner of the company that runs it.

    Lots of them round Norwich airport. Vulcan Rd North and South, Hurricance Way, Spitifre Road, Anson Road, Liberator Road, Meteor Close, Javelin Road, Stirling Road, Audax Road, Beaufort Close, Heyford Road, Marauder Road, Defiant Road to name but some. Also Dowding and Mallory roads
